Grammy-nominated artist Jelly Roll opens up about his turbulent past, from felony charges to addiction, and his transformative journey to self-forgiveness. In this raw and emotional conversation, he reveals the struggles behind his music, his mission to help others, and how he learned to love himself and overcome his past.
